I've just recently switched to a satellite ISP (from cellular which was getting too expensive - no other high speed options in our location).

I've adapted to the lag times for the most part. A bit frustrating still, but you do get used to it. It still beats dialup 8=)

But AWeber has been giving me problems with editing emails. It seems that their new block editor uses some JavaScript API that doesn't work well when signals get delayed. It will save a copy of what I'm working on every 2 minutes. When I hit save, it seems to save it (and it appears in the list of snapshots).

But when I get to the schedule page or followup timing page and try to "Save & Exit" it just hangs. If it does come up with an error message (which sometimes happens) then it says something about security software being a possible problem. But it isn't.

When I go back to the email list I will see the draft. Sometimes the email is saved (but not always) and the scheduling is not. Other times it all gets saved.

This happens in IE, Firefox and Chrome, so I know it isn't the browser. The firewall is set to allow all of them to come through.

Support gave me a link to a page to clear cookies and cache. That sometimes works, but not always. Even restarting the browser doesn't always work. And it is a pain to have to re-login all the time.

Support seems to be of the opinion that changing the timeout limits on the JavaScript would break things, so I doubt they'll do anything to fix this. Although as a programmer myself I don't understand how adding a couple seconds to a timeout would cause anything to go wrong. But I haven't got access (or time) to review their code.

So, is anyone else seeing these kinds of problems with AWeber? Are you using satellite? Or is there anyone who is using satellite and finds AWeber working fine?

I've tried using the old editor to do an email and it seems to work much better. And the form editor doesn't seem to be showing any problems. It seems to be related to the new email block style editor (which I'm not sure I like anyway 8=)
